Free agent QB Vince Young has announced his retirement from the NFL.
"I'm retired," Young said. "Unless we get a great opportunity, something guaranteed, I've started moving forward. It's definitely official, in my book." Young briefly signed with the Browns in May, but was released prior to minicamp. He hasn't appeared in an NFL game since 2011. Young went 31-19 in six years as a starter, passing for 8,964 career yards, 46 touchdowns, and 51 interceptions. He made two Pro Bowl appearances. Young, 31, said he plans to work for the University of Texas in some capacity.

49ers CB Eric Wright is retiring.
Only 29 (next month), Wright is barely two years removed from signing a five-year, $37.5 million contract with the Bucs, but has seen his career go down in flames since getting his big deal. He served a four-game PED ban in 2012, and was busted for DUI last summer. He was released by the Bucs shortly thereafter. Wright signed with the Niners in August, but was limited to 120 defensive snaps across seven games last season. We'd assume Wright will be open to un-retiring if the right offer comes along.

Texans waived QB T.J. Yates.
The move comes on the same day coach Bill O'Brien admitted Ryan Fitzpatrick was the Texans' starter. Yates was set to do battle with Case Keenum and rookie Tom Savage for No. 2 duties, and Keenum for a roster spot. Instead, the Texans chose Keenum's 2013 film over Yates' distant 2011 accomplishments, where he was at the helm for Houston's first franchise playoff victory. Yates figures to draw interest from the Ravens, who are thin behind Joe Flacco, and have Yates' former coach Gary Kubiak calling the shots on offense.
